How much does it cost to rent an apartment in 23603?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| 23603 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,105 | $965 | $1,315 |
| 23603 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,320 | $1,015 | $1,699 |
| 23603 3 Bedroom Apartments | $1,746 | $1,400 | $1,930 |
| 23603 4 Bedroom Apartments | $2,173 | $1,970 | $2,275 |
